Common Causes of Buzzing Temperature Spikes
1. Cooling System Failures
The cooling system is crucial for maintaining your engine’s temperature. If there’s a failure in this system, it can lead to overheating and buzzing noises. Common issues include:
- Low Coolant Levels: If your coolant is low, it can’t effectively absorb heat, causing the engine to overheat.
- Faulty Thermostat: A malfunctioning thermostat can prevent coolant from flowing properly, leading to temperature spikes.
- Clogged Radiator: Dirt and debris can block the radiator, reducing its ability to cool the engine.
2. Electrical Issues
Sometimes, the buzzing noise can stem from electrical problems within your vehicle. Here are a few culprits:
- Faulty Sensors: Temperature sensors that are malfunctioning can send incorrect readings to the engine control unit (ECU), causing the engine to overheat.
- Wiring Problems: Damaged or frayed wiring can create electrical shorts, leading to buzzing sounds and erratic temperature readings.
3. Engine Overload
When your engine is working harder than it should, it can lead to buzzing noises and temperature spikes. This can happen due to:
- Heavy Loads: Towing or carrying excessive weight can strain the engine, causing it to overheat.
- Climbing Steep Grades: Driving uphill can put additional stress on the engine, leading to increased temperatures.
4. Exhaust System Problems
Issues within the exhaust system can also contribute to buzzing noises and overheating. Consider the following:
- Blocked Exhaust: A blockage can cause back pressure, leading to engine strain and temperature increases.
- Leaking Exhaust Manifold: A leak can cause the engine to run inefficiently, resulting in overheating.
5. Oil Issues
Oil plays a vital role in keeping your engine cool and lubricated. If there are problems with your oil, it can lead to overheating:
- Low Oil Levels: Insufficient oil can lead to increased friction and heat, causing the engine to overheat.
- Dirty Oil: Old or contaminated oil can lose its effectiveness, leading to poor lubrication and overheating.
6. Fan Malfunctions
The cooling fan helps regulate engine temperature. If it’s not functioning correctly, it can lead to overheating:
- Broken Fan Blades: Damaged blades can reduce airflow, leading to higher temperatures.
- Faulty Fan Motor: If the motor fails, the fan won’t operate, causing the engine to overheat.
7. Air Intake Issues
The air intake system is essential for proper engine function. If there are issues here, it can lead to overheating:
- Blocked Air Filter: A dirty air filter can restrict airflow, causing the engine to run hotter.
- Vacuum Leaks: Leaks can disrupt the air-fuel mixture, leading to inefficient combustion and overheating.
8. Transmission Problems
Believe it or not, transmission issues can also lead to temperature spikes. Here’s how:
- Overheating Transmission Fluid: If the transmission fluid is low or old, it can overheat, affecting engine performance.
- Slipping Gears: If the transmission is not engaging properly, it can cause the engine to work harder, leading to overheating.
9. Fuel System Issues
Problems with the fuel system can also contribute to engine overheating:
- Clogged Fuel Filter: A clogged filter can restrict fuel flow, causing the engine to run lean and overheat.
- Faulty Fuel Pump: If the pump isn’t delivering enough fuel, it can lead to overheating.
10. Ignition System Problems
Finally, issues with the ignition system can lead to temperature spikes:
- Misfiring Cylinders: If the engine is misfiring, it can cause excessive heat buildup.
- Faulty Spark Plugs: Worn or damaged spark plugs can lead to inefficient combustion, causing the engine to overheat.

DIY Diagnostic Steps
If you notice buzzing noises and temperature spikes, here are some actionable steps you can take to diagnose the issue:
1. Check Coolant Levels
Open the hood and inspect the coolant reservoir. If the level is low, top it off with the appropriate coolant mixture. Make sure to check for leaks around hoses and the radiator.
2. Inspect for Leaks
Look under your vehicle for any signs of coolant or oil leaks. Puddles of fluid can indicate a serious problem that needs immediate attention.
3. Listen for Unusual Noises
While the engine is running, listen for any strange sounds, such as rattling or buzzing. These noises can provide clues about the source of the problem.
4. Monitor Temperature Gauge
Keep an eye on the temperature gauge while driving. If it spikes into the red zone, pull over immediately to prevent further damage.
5. Check Engine Light
If the check engine light is illuminated, use an OBD-II scanner to read the error codes. This can help pinpoint the issue more accurately.
6. Inspect Electrical Connections
Check the wiring and connectors related to the cooling system and temperature sensors. Look for frayed wires or loose connections that could cause electrical issues.
7. Test the Thermostat
If you suspect a faulty thermostat, you can test it by removing it and placing it in boiling water. If it doesn’t open, it needs to be replaced.

How to Fix It and Expected Repair Costs
When it comes to addressing buzzing temperature spikes in your vehicle, understanding the repair options available and their associated costs is essential. Depending on the underlying cause, repairs can vary significantly in complexity and price. Below, we’ll explore typical repair options, what a mechanic will usually do, and general price ranges for each type of repair.
1. Cooling System Repairs
The cooling system is often the first area to investigate when dealing with temperature spikes. Here are common repairs associated with cooling system failures:
Typical Repairs
- Coolant flush and replacement
- Replacing a faulty thermostat
- Repairing or replacing hoses and clamps
- Radiator repair or replacement
Expected Costs
Repair costs for cooling system issues can range from:
- Coolant flush: $100 – $150
- Thermostat replacement: $150 – $300
- Hose replacement: $50 – $200 (depending on the hose)
- Radiator replacement: $300 – $1,000 (including labor)
2. Electrical System Repairs
If electrical issues are causing the buzzing noise and temperature spikes, a mechanic will typically perform the following:
Typical Repairs
- Diagnosing and repairing faulty sensors
- Repairing or replacing damaged wiring
- Replacing the engine control unit (ECU) if necessary
Expected Costs
Electrical repairs can vary widely based on the issue:
- Sensor replacement: $100 – $300
- Wiring repair: $50 – $150 (depending on the extent of damage)
- ECU replacement: $500 – $1,500 (including programming)
3. Engine Overload Solutions
Addressing engine overload often involves optimizing performance and ensuring the engine operates within its limits:
Typical Repairs
- Adjusting or replacing the engine tuning
- Upgrading the cooling system (e.g., larger radiator or better fans)
- Weight reduction strategies (removing unnecessary items)
Expected Costs
Costs for engine overload solutions can include:
- Engine tuning: $300 – $600
- Cooling system upgrades: $200 – $800
- Weight reduction: Varies widely based on modifications
4. Exhaust System Repairs
If the exhaust system is the culprit, repairs may involve:
Typical Repairs
- Replacing a damaged exhaust manifold
- Repairing or replacing mufflers and pipes
- Clearing blockages in the exhaust system
Expected Costs
Exhaust system repairs can range from:
- Exhaust manifold replacement: $300 – $800
- Muffler replacement: $100 – $300
- Clearing blockages: $50 – $150
5. Oil System Repairs
Addressing oil-related issues is critical for engine health. Common repairs include:
Typical Repairs
- Oil change and filter replacement
- Repairing oil leaks
- Replacing oil pumps if necessary
Expected Costs
Costs for oil system repairs typically include:
- Oil change: $30 – $100
- Oil leak repair: $100 – $500 (depending on the source of the leak)
- Oil pump replacement: $300 – $800
6. Fan and Air Intake Repairs
For issues related to the cooling fan or air intake, repairs may involve:
Typical Repairs
- Replacing the cooling fan motor
- Repairing or replacing air filters
- Fixing vacuum leaks in the intake system
Expected Costs
Costs for fan and air intake repairs can range from:
- Cooling fan motor replacement: $200 – $500
- Air filter replacement: $20 – $50
- Vacuum leak repair: $100 – $300
7. Transmission and Fuel System Repairs
If transmission or fuel system issues are suspected, mechanics will typically:
Typical Repairs
- Flush and replace transmission fluid
- Repair or replace the fuel pump
- Replace clogged fuel filters
Expected Costs
Costs for these repairs can include:
- Transmission fluid flush: $100 – $200
- Fuel pump replacement: $300 – $800
- Fuel filter replacement: $50 – $150
